Per Mike Wang / Beluba, the new shooting controls are absolute only, with no chance of patching in relative controls.

For someone like myself that plays on the broadcast cam with relative controls, this could be a big deal. I've tried absolute controls before and hated them. Moving the sticks contradictory to what I see on screen is unsettling.

Would I continue to use relative controls for isomotion with absolute controls for shooting? Would I switch to absolute controls for isomotion for the consistency? I'll have to try it out prior.

Yeah. No more holding LT/L2 and autocontesting. I don't even think there is an option to turn it on, unless it is off by default.

I think this kind of goes both ways. On one hand it puts more control in the users hands and requires us to be more active on defense. It also takes removes the possibility of error, contesting on a pump fake only contesting unwillingly. On the other hand I did like that your could contest a shot without fully going for the block that way you had a chance to recover instead of being taken out of the play.

I would like them to implement a feature similar to Live where you could light contest, which was more a hand in the face, or go for a straight up block.
